By Princess Ugorji (VANGUARD) It was joyous day for the women of Assemblies of God Church, Isolo, Lagos as they held the annual women’s programme at the Church premises, recently. The women who turned up in large numbers portrayed the fact that if they were to come back to this life, they will come back as women. They were obviously overwhelmed with the joy of the day and hinted on how they have been successful with raising their children and working in the vineyard of God at the same time.
Wife of the senior pastor of the church, Mrs. Caroline Okeremgbo, ascribed the success attained by the women in their various endeavours to God, saying that it had been God from the beginning of the ministry. She said that the major challenges she has faced so far was taking care of her children because as she had more children, she seemed to have less time for herself.
Speaking further, Okeremgbo noted: “In the church, women have different characters but you have to ensure that they are happy.” She added that it’s not been easy but it has been God all through.
The Women President, Mrs. Ekpa Eteta explained that as the woman president for a long time, her major challenge was the fact that they attend meetings late or don’t even attend organised meetings at all.
“Combining the task of a leader in the church, mother and grandmother has not been easy but first of all, my home must be in order”, she noted. She added that determination has been one of the things that had helped all through.
Eteta who admitted that at the beginning it was tedious, advised younger women to be committed to God and take everything to God. She revealed further that, the success she has attained today did not come when she became a leader but had started when she was not a leader but today God is being glorified.
